[m-rev.] diff: remove another unnecessary package dependency

Julien Fischer juliensf at cs.mu.OZ.AU
Mon Mar 21 16:06:16 AEDT 2005


Estimated hours taken: 0.5
Branches: main

Remove another unnecessary package dependency in the compiler.

compiler/ml_backend.m:
	Don't import the transform_hlds package, it isn't needed.

	Document why the check_hlds package need to be imported.

Julien.

Workspace:/home/swordfish/juliensf/ws70
Index: compiler/ml_backend.m
===================================================================
RCS file: /home/mercury1/repository/mercury/compiler/ml_backend.m,v
retrieving revision 1.8
diff -u -r1.8 ml_backend.m
--- compiler/ml_backend.m	19 Jan 2005 03:10:42 -0000	1.8
+++ compiler/ml_backend.m	21 Mar 2005 05:01:50 -0000
@@ -78,9 +78,9 @@

 :- import_module backend_libs.
 :- import_module libs.
-:- import_module check_hlds.	 % is this needed?
+:- import_module check_hlds.	% needed for type_util, mode_util,
+				% and polymorphism.
 :- import_module mdbcomp.
-:- import_module transform_hlds. % is this needed?
 :- import_module aditi_backend. % need aditi_backend.rl_file

 :- end_module ml_backend.

--------------------------------------------------------------------------
mercury-reviews mailing list
post:  mercury-reviews at cs.mu.oz.au
administrative address: owner-mercury-reviews at cs.mu.oz.au
unsubscribe: Address: mercury-reviews-request at cs.mu.oz.au Message: unsubscribe
subscribe:   Address: mercury-reviews-request at cs.mu.oz.au Message: subscribe
--------------------------------------------------------------------------



More information about the reviews mailing list